    Overview

    The Product Analyst / Consulting-Level reviews, analyzes, and evaluates information technology systems operations. In this role you will be part of a team that delivers Healthcare IT applications. Team is Denial Notification Application (DNA) and app is now almost 2 years old. Main goal of project is to come off MIDAS, an external product that will be sunsetted by mid 2026. DNA application will be taking over a piece of what MIDAS was used for. In addition to that, there is a lot of investment being put into DNA to expand it's features and capabilities beyond just current denial notifications.
